How much do postdoctoral food engineering jobs pay per year?

As of Jun 6, 2026, the average yearly pay for postdoctoral food engineering in the United States is $59,022.00, according to ZipRecruiter salary data. Most workers in this role earn between $49,000.00 and $66,500.00 per year, depending on experience, location, and employer.

What are typical collaboration opportunities for a Postdoctoral Food Engineering researcher within academia and industry?

As a Postdoctoral Food Engineering researcher, you will frequently collaborate with multidisciplinary teams, including food scientists, chemical engineers, microbiologists, and industry partners. These collaborations often involve joint research projects, process optimization studies, and technology transfer initiatives. You'll have the opportunity to contribute to grant proposals, co-author publications, and participate in conferences, all of which can broaden your professional network and open doors for future academic or industry roles. Engaging with industry partners may also provide practical experience and insight into commercial applications of your research.

Postdoctoral Food Engineering focuses on the application of engineering principles to food processing, equipment, and manufacturing systems. In contrast, Postdoctoral Food Science emphasizes understanding food composition, safety, and quality. Both roles require advanced degrees and are often found in research settings or industry, but they differ in their core focus areas and practical applications.

What are the key skills and qualifications needed to thrive as a Postdoctoral Food Engineer, and why are they important?

To thrive as a Postdoctoral Food Engineer, you need advanced knowledge in food science, process engineering, and experimental design, typically backed by a PhD in food engineering or a related discipline. Familiarity with analytical instrumentation, laboratory information management systems (LIMS), and statistical software like MATLAB or R is commonly expected. Strong problem-solving skills, effective communication, and the ability to work independently and collaboratively distinguish top candidates. These skills are essential for advancing innovative research, ensuring experimental accuracy, and contributing to multidisciplinary teams in academic or industry settings.

What are postdoctoral food engineers?

Postdoctoral food engineers are researchers who have completed their doctoral studies (PhD) in food engineering or a related field and are pursuing advanced research, typically in academic or industrial settings. Their work often involves developing new food processing techniques, improving food safety, or enhancing food quality through innovative engineering solutions. They may also supervise students, publish scientific papers, and collaborate with industry partners to solve real-world food production challenges. Postdoctoral positions are usually temporary and are meant to help researchers gain further experience and expertise before moving on to permanent roles in academia, industry, or government.

Position Description
A postdoctoral scholar is sought to study and understand the physical principles underlying how natural dyes and pigments affect the color of foods. Natural dyes and pigments are difficult to incorporate in food formulations because they are generally not as photostable as synthetic dyes, and they are not as easy to disperse or dissolve. The candidate will join the group of Prof. Vinothan N. Manoharan at Harvard SEAS to develop an understanding of how the physical states of the dye and other components in the food formulation determine the color. The project combines experimental characterization (spectroscopy, microscopy, and light scattering) with modeling of light transport. The postdoc will primarily work on the experimental studies but will also have the opportunity to participate in computational and analytical modeling. This postdoc will also be responsible for reporting results to the industrial sponsor of the project.
